A body of length 1 m having cross-sectional area 0.75 m² has heat flow through it at the rate of 6000 joule/sec. Then find the temperature difference if K=200 Jm⁻¹K⁻¹

Options

(a) 20⁰C
(b) 40⁰C
(c) 80⁰C
(d) 100⁰C

Correct Answer:

40⁰C
